Terros Health is pleased to share an exciting and rewarding opportunity for a Technology Business Liaison working at our Central Ave location in Phoenix, AZ. The Technology Business Liaison serves as the strategic bridge between Terros Health's clinical, operational, and administrative teams and the IT organization. This role ensures that technology solutions align with business needs, support integrated care delivery, and advance organizational priorities. The Technology Business Liaison gathers business requirements, translates business requirements into actionable IT work, improves communication flow, and helps leaders make informed decisions about systems, data, and digital workflows. This role is critical to improving speed, clarity, and alignment across the agency ensuring that IT delivers solutions with measurable impact.

Bachelor's degree in Business, Healthcare Administration, Information Systems, or related field (or equivalent experience)
3+ years of experience in business analysis, IT liaison work, project coordination, or healthcare operations
Strong understanding of clinical or operational workflows in healthcare or behavioral health settings.
Ability to translate complex technical concepts into plain language
Excellent communication, facilitation, and relationship‑building skills
Must have a valid Arizona driver's license, be 21 years of age with a minimum of 3 years driving experience, and meet requirements of Terros Health's driving policy
Must successfully pass a TB screening and criminal background check
